Dataset

This dataset presents the data corresponding to PhD thesis titled “Shear behavior of concrete structures strengthened with ultra-high performance fiber-reinforced concrete (UHPFRC)”. Folder chapters 3 and 4 include the experimental data of tested UHPFRC-Concrete hybrid beams with varying parameters. The experimental data include the data for load-deformation response, load-interface displacement, and the DIC images for the cracking process and crack width calculation. In chapter 5, it contains the temperature data of both small and large-scale specimens for thermal analysis in order to detect the delamination between UHPFRC and concrete. In Chapter 6, the dataset contains the magnetic inductance for small and large-scale specimens to investigate the fiber distribution and orientation in UHPFRC elements.
